#b012fe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b012fe is composed of 69% red, 7.1% green and 99.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 30.7% cyan, 92.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 280.2 degrees, a saturation of 99.2% and a lightness of 53.3%. #b012fe color hex could be obtained by blending #ff24ff with #6100fd. Closest websafe color is: #9900ff.

#b012fe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b012fe has RGB values of R:176, G:18, B:254 and CMYK values of C:0.31, M:0.93, Y:0, K:0. Its decimal value is 11539198.

Shades and Tints of #b012fe
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0011 is the darkest color, while #fefcff is the lightest one.

Tones of #b012fe
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8b8090 is the less saturated color, while #b012fe is the most saturated one.
